One interpretation of the painting an Allegory with Venus and Cupid by Bronzino is that the background figures?

The boy to the right represents Folly. The girl behind him is Pleasure.The old man is Time.The screaming figure to the left is Jealousy.The one top left is probably Fraud.This is the interpretation supported by the National Gallery of London, the home of this painting.

Many Painting Techniques, No Right One?

There are many different painting techniques. Each one has it’s own pluses and minuses,, and some people are better at one technique and terrible at others. A few of the best painting techniques to decorate a home are sponge painting, strppling, paneling, and sponge painting. They are all quite different from one another but also very fun to do. Employing any of these painting techniques will add character and charm to the home. One technique that takes only the most basic of instruction and very little preparation is dappling paint onto the wall. The best way to learn new and interesting painting techniques is to start with a small and easily manageable project. By starting small, it is easy to successfully complete the project. Once the project is completed, the individual will have gained confidence that will come in handy on a larger painting job. Most special painting techniques involve some sort of broken color. Broken color is the term for applying colors in layers that are broken and laid over different base color coats in order to create textured or mottled effect. This usually involves applying different washes and glazes over a solid background. These glazes are composed of oil paint that is mixed with transparent washes and linseed oil. They are best when the paint remains open and is usable for a much longer time period. The washes are latex paint that is thinned by using water that produces colorant. This allows the paint to appear fresher, more delicate, and even purer. These washes are also much easier to clean up and modify than other types of paint. This simple fact makes washes much more appealing than other options that are available to beginning painters. Sponge painting is another quick and easy painting technique. This technique involves applying paint with a sponge on top of the base. This is generally a very well-liked technique. People seem to like the way it looks, and it is very easy for a beginner to have good results with it. Whatever painting techniques a person attempts, it is important that he or she has fun. Painting is one of the great sources of pleasure in life. The fact that there are so many different and interesting techniques just makes it more enjoyable.


Who painted Captain Daniel Gregg's portrait in The Ghost and Mrs Muir?

Answer -- If you are looking for an answer from the movie or the TV show, there isn't one. It was never stated. According to the book, Daniel Gregg said that the painting was done by a man who paid for his sea passage that way -- and that the painter was also a bigamist! No name was ever given. If you are asking what person (alive) painted the portrait for the movie, I am clueless, but if you are asking who painted the portrait for the TV show, I don't know the name of the artist, but he retained ownership of the painting. When the series was cancelled after two years, the artist offered to sell it to the TV ghost, Edward Mulhare for some very large sum -- like $30.000. Mulhare declined. The painting then went up for auction at Sotheby's Auction house and was sold to a private buyer. Its whereabouts today in 2008 are unknown. The name of the artist who painted the sea captain was John George Vogel. He was an English portrait painter. The reason I know is because he also worked on another portrait entitled, "The Lady" which won first international prize. His show was in the Francis Taylor Gallery (owned by Elizabeth Taylor's father) in Beverly Hills.
